About Your Trip

Come to Rockport, Texas, and join Captain Rob who’s going to help you catch fish and have a great time while fishing inshore, reefs, and flats that the bay system surrounding Rockport has to offer! Specifically, Captain Rob will take you to fish in one or a couple of the bays around the Texas Coastal Bend like Mesquite Bay, Copano Bay, St. Charles Bay, Aransas Bay, or Cedar Bayou, all of which are legendary fisheries.

Captain Rob specializes in bottom fishing and using light tackle to fish these bays. These are his favorite methods for getting you on fish like Spotted Seatrout, Redfish, Black Drum, Flounder, and Sheepshead.

Furthermore, Captain Rob will cater your trip around your goals for the day. So depending on your skill level, where you want to fish, and what methods you want to use, Capt. Rob is willing to work with you to make your dreams come true out on the water!

Captain Rob will meet you at the dock ready with all the fishing gear you could need. This includes rods, reels, terminal tackle, as well as live bait and lures. The crew will also clean and fillet the fish you catch with no extra charges, so you can take it home and prepare some tasty meals. So all you need to bring are your favorite snacks and drinks, your sun protection, and your Texas fishing license, Captain Rob will take care of the rest to ensure you have a successful and fun day out on the water!

Each trip’s price is set by the guide and factors in all of their costs. A big determinant of cost is often the type of boat and associated fuel costs, but other guide costs include leases, marina / slip fees, bait costs, and the cost to provide and maintain all of the gear you’ll need on your trip.
